Why Smart Appliances Matter

Traditional appliances often consume more energy than necessary, operating at full power regardless of need. Smart appliances, on the other hand, use sensors, scheduling, and integration with your home’s energy system to optimise how and when they run. Many also connect to apps on your phone, giving you greater control and insight into your energy consumption. Not only do they lower your bills, but they also support a more environmentally friendly lifestyle by reducing unnecessary energy wastage.

Smart Appliances That Can Help Reduce Energy Costs

Smart Thermostats and Heating Systems

Heating and cooling account for a large portion of household energy use. Smart thermostats learn your daily routines and adjust the temperature accordingly. They can turn off when you’re away and ensure your home is comfortable when you return. Many models can even be controlled remotely, giving you full flexibility.

Energy-Efficient Smart Lighting

Smart lighting allows you to set schedules, dim lights automatically, or even turn them off when no one is in the room. LED smart bulbs use far less energy than traditional bulbs and can be integrated with motion sensors for even greater savings.

Smart Washing Machines and Dryers

Laundry appliances are notorious for consuming energy and water. Smart washing machines can adjust the water and cycle length based on load size, while smart dryers can detect moisture levels to avoid over-drying. Over time, these small adjustments translate into significant energy and cost savings.

Smart Refrigerators

Modern smart fridges use advanced sensors to optimise cooling and energy use. They can notify you if the door is left open, monitor energy consumption, and even suggest optimal temperature settings. Some models also allow you to track expiry dates and shopping lists, helping reduce food waste.

Smart Plugs and Power Strips

Not every appliance needs to be replaced to achieve energy savings. By using smart plugs or smart power strips, you can monitor and control the energy use of your existing devices. These tools are especially useful for cutting off standby power, which can quietly add up on your bill.
